## Useful scripts
### Syncing events for all local nostr users from a remote relay
You can sync all events of all local users with a pubkey stored in LDAP from a
specified remote relay to the local relay with the `strfry-sync.ts` script:
deno run -A /opt/strfry-sync.ts wss://relay.example.com
Doing the same with Docker Compose (great for seeding data to your local relay
in development):
docker compose run strfry deno run -A /opt/strfry-sync.ts wss://relay.example.com
## Docker image
In order to use the LDAP policy with Docker, you will need
[Deno](https://deno.com/) installed in your strfry container. We provide a
custom Docker image for strfry with Deno included (which we use in
development):
* Registry: https://gitea.kosmos.org/kosmos/-/packages/container/strfry-deno/1.1.1
* Source: https://github.com/raucao/strfry/blob/docker_deno/ubuntu.Dockerfile
